Basic information   
Locus name AT4G35010
AliasBGAL11
OrganismArabidopsis thaliana
Taxonomic identifier[NCBI]
Function categoryOthers
Effect for Senescenceunclear
Gene Descriptionbeta-galactosidase 11 (BGAL11); FUNCTIONS IN: beta-galactosidase activity; INVOLVED IN: lactose catabolic process, using glucoside 3-dehydrogenase, carbohydrate metabolic process, lactose catabolic process via UDP-galactose, lactose catabolic process; LOCATED IN: endomembrane system, beta-galactosidase complex; EXPRESSED IN: 10 plant structures; EXPRESSED DURING: L mature pollen stage, M germinated pollen stage, 4 anthesis, C globular stage, petal differentiation and expansion stage; CONTAINS InterPro DOMAIN/s: Glycoside hydrolase family 2, carbohydrate-binding (InterPro:IPR006104), Glycoside hydrolase, family 35 (InterPro:IPR001944), D-galactoside/L-rhamnose binding SUEL lectin (InterPro:IPR000922), Glycoside hydrolase, catalytic core (InterPro:IPR017853), Glycoside hydrolase, subgroup, catalytic core (InterPro:IPR013781), Galactose-binding like (InterPro:IPR008979); BEST Arabidopsis thaliana protein match is: BGAL13; beta-galactosidase (TAIR:AT2G16730.1); Has 1404 Blast hits to 1221 proteins in 271 species: Archae - 11; Bacteria - 446; Metazoa - 368; Fungi - 122; Plants - 383; Viruses - 0; Other Eukaryotes - 74 (source: NCBI BLink).
EvidenceGenomic evidence:microarray data [Ref 1]
